This four-day fest is a feast of sinister cinema across genre with one common thread: their unsettling and unconventional nature. Unnerving storylines will leap off the screens with a vengeance, including The Triptych of the Keeper, Navel Gazer, The Return of the Näcken and The Girls in the Walls.
The four-day event spotlights both feature-length and short films that dwell in the “twisted corridors of unconventional cinema.” The top 13 films that embody the spirit of BizarroLand and “cinematic weirdness” receive a coveted Sickie award during a capstone awards show.
Stay sick, as a wise man once said.
Thursday-Sunday, Dec. 12-15, Epic Theatres at Lee Vista, 5901 Hazeltine National Drive, bizarrolandfilm.com, $15-$125.
